RCC Design by B.C. Punmia: The Ultimate Guide for Civil Engineering Students

If you are a civil engineering student or a practicing structural engineer in India, the name Dr. B.C. Punmia needs no introduction. His textbook, Reinforced Concrete Structures (Volume 1 & 2), has been the cornerstone of structural design education for decades.

With the rise of digital learning, many students search for "RCC design by B.C. Punmia PDF free download" to access this wealth of knowledge on their tablets and laptops. In this article, we’ll dive into what makes this book essential and how you can access it responsibly. Why B.C. Punmia’s RCC Design is a Must-Read

Reinforced Cement Concrete (RCC) is the backbone of modern infrastructure. Understanding how to design safe, economical, and durable structures is a critical skill. Dr. Punmia’s approach stands out for several reasons:

Simplified Concepts: Complex theories of limit state design and working stress methods are broken down into easy-to-understand language.

Step-by-Step Solved Examples: The book is famous for its exhaustive collection of numerical problems. Each step is clearly explained, making it perfect for exam preparation.

Adherence to IS Codes: The content is strictly based on Indian Standard codes (specifically IS 456:2000), which is the mandatory guideline for RCC design in India.

Comprehensive Coverage: From basic beam design to complex structures like retaining walls and water tanks, the book covers the entire spectrum of RCC. Key Topics Covered in the Book

The book is typically divided into two volumes. Here is a glimpse of the core syllabus covered:

Introduction to RCC: Properties of concrete and steel, and the philosophy of design.

Limit State Method (LSM): Analysis and design of singly and doubly reinforced beams, T-beams, and L-beams.

Shear and Torsion: Understanding diagonal tension and how to design stirrups and bent-up bars.

Slabs: Design of one-way and two-way slabs with various boundary conditions.

Columns and Footings: Design of short and slender columns, and isolated and combined footings.

Staircases: Different types of stairs and their reinforcement detailing.

Retaining Walls: Design of cantilever and counterfort retaining walls.

The Search for "RCC Design by B.C. Punmia PDF Free Download"

It is tempting to look for a free PDF version of such an expensive and bulky textbook. However, there are a few things to consider: 1. Copyright and Ethics

Dr. B.C. Punmia’s works are copyrighted by Laxmi Publications. Downloading unauthorized "free" PDFs from third-party websites is often a violation of copyright laws. It also deprives the authors and publishers of the resources needed to update and maintain the quality of these educational materials. 2. Risk of Outdated Editions

RCC design standards (IS Codes) change over time. Many free PDFs found online are scanned copies of older editions. Using an outdated version could lead to learning design methods that are no longer compliant with current engineering safety standards. 3. Malware Risks

Websites offering "free downloads" of popular textbooks often contain intrusive ads or malware that can compromise your device’s security. How to Access the Book Legally
